With the high-amplitude sucking procedure, newborns were presented with two lists of phonetically varied Japanese words differing in pitch contour. Discrimination of the lists was found, thus indicating that newborns are able to extract pitch contour information at the word level.  相似文献

The auditory tau and the kappa effects show that there is time-pitch interdependence in our perception. Our judgments of pitch separation between two tones depend on the temporal interval between them (the auditory tau effect), and our judgments of the tones’ temporal interval depend on their pitch separation (the kappa effect). The mechanisms underlying this interdependence were investigated by studying the auditory tau and the kappa effect in three experiments. Comparisons were made between results obtained from subjects with absolute pitch and those who did not have absolute pitch, and two frequency ranges of pure tones (octave and whole-tone conditions) were selected. The procedures had been used in previous experiments (Shigeno, 1986), in which the auditory tau and the kappa effects were compared in speech and nonspeech stimuli. The present results demonstrate that the auditory tau effect does not occur when possessors of absolute pitch judge the closeness of stimuli in pitch, except when the stimulus continuum consists of tones that do not correspond to musical notes in the whole-tone condition. The kappa effect was obtained in the judgment of possessors of absolute pitch in both the octave and the whole-tone conditions. These findings suggest that the interaction between temporal interval and pitch judgment might be explained in terms of the two different memory modes for retaining the pitch of tones, and that these effects occur at the precategorical level.  相似文献

This paper focuses on Michael Balint's special application of psychoanalysis, originally conceived as a training of doctors. Then the attempt is made to discover indirectly, since Balint never described his method in context, what he thought mattered in terms of method. Besides Balint's own contributions, those of his own staff are also consulted as well as the cultural background of the Tavistock Clinic and the Tavistock Institute. Then the further developments of the Balint method in the German-speaking world are presented. At the center are the special features of the method: (a) the atmosphere, (b) the narrator's contribution, (c) listening and reactions of the members of the group, (d) the unconscious enactments in transference and countertransference and the mirror-phenomena, respectively. Furthermore, the respective central points of reference are discussed from the viewpoint of communication science: (a) case, (b) group, and (c) institution. In conclusion and based on these foundations, the characteristics of the application of the Balint method in the form of a particular profession-related supervision are presented.  相似文献

Pitch perception is determined by both place and temporal cues. To explore whether the manner in which these cues are used differs depending on absolute pitch capability, pitch identification experiments with and without pitch references were conducted for subjects with different absolute pitch capabilities and musical experience. Three types of stimuli were used to manipulate place and temporal cues separately: narrowband noises, which provide strong place cues but less salient temporal cues; iterated rippled noises, which provide strong temporal cues but less salient place cues; and sinusoidal tones, which provide both. The results indicated that absolute pitch possessors utilize temporal cues more effectively when they identify musical chroma With regard to the judgment of height, it was indicated that place cues play an important role for both absolute and nonabsolute pitch possessors.  相似文献

Two studies examined the link between intergroup discrimination involving negative outcomes (i.e., removal of positive resources and allocation of noxious resources), global self‐esteem (GSE), and collective self‐esteem (CSE). Study 1 found that New Zealanders who took away more positive resources from out‐group than in‐group members experienced enhanced CSE, but not GSE. These findings were replicated in Study 2, with respect to the allocation of noxious resources (i.e., white noise). New Zealanders' GSE and CSE assessed prior to the allocation of noxious resources were unrelated to the subsequent allocation of white noise. The data are interpreted to indicate that intergroup discrimination involving negative outcomes leads to enhanced CSE. However, neither GSE nor CSE predict such discrimination.  相似文献

Ann-rowed correlation matrix may be thought of as an ellipsoid inn-dimensional space with its center at the origin. The principal components of the matrix are essentially the semi-axes of the ellipsoid. A direct and simple method of computing the lengths and directions of these semi-axes is presented.  相似文献

Knowledge monitoring predicts academic outcomes in many contexts. However, measures of knowledge monitoring accuracy are often incomplete. In the current study, a measure of students’ ability to discriminate known from unknown information as a component of knowledge monitoring was considered. Undergraduate students’ knowledge monitoring accuracy was assessed and used to predict final exam scores in a specific course. It was found that gamma, a measure commonly used as the measure of knowledge monitoring accuracy, accounted for a small, but significant amount of variance in academic performance whereas the discrimination and bias indexes combined to account for a greater amount of variance in academic performance.  相似文献

Responses to S− (“errors”) are not a necessary condition for the formation of an operant discrimination of color. Errors do not occur if discrimination training begins early in conditioning and if S+ and S− initially differ with respect to brightness, duration and wavelength. After training starts, S−'s duration and brightness is progressively increased until S+ and S− differ only with respect to wavelength. Errors do occur if training starts after much conditioning in the presence of S+ has occurred or if S+ and S− differ only with respect to wavelength throughout training. Performance following discrimination learning without errors lacks three characteristics that are found following learning with errors. Only those birds that learned the discrimination with errors showed (1) “emotional” responses in the presence of S−, (2) an increase in the rate (or a decrease in the latency) of its response to S+, and (3) occasional bursts of responses to S−.  相似文献

Levitin's findings that nonmusicians could produce from memory the absolute pitches of self-selected pop songs have been widely cited in the music psychology literature. These findings suggest that latent absolute pitch (AP) memory may be a more widespread trait within the population than traditional AP labelling ability. However, it has been left unclear what factors may facilitate absolute pitch retention for familiar pieces of music. The aim of the present paper was to investigate factors that may contribute to latent AP memory using Levitin's sung production paradigm for AP memory and comparing results to the outcomes of a pitch labelling task, a relative pitch memory test, measures of music-induced emotions, and various measures of participants' musical backgrounds. Our results suggest that relative pitch memory and the quality and degree of music-elicited emotions impact on latent AP memory.  相似文献

Absolute pitch (AP) is the ability to identify or produce notes without any reference note. An ongoing debate exists regarding the benefits or disadvantages of AP in processing music. One of the main issues in this context is whether the categorical perception of pitch in AP possessors may interfere in processing tasks requiring relative pitch (RP). Previous studies, focusing mainly on melodic and interval perception, have obtained inconsistent results. The aim of the present study was to examine the effect of AP and RP separately, using isolated chords. Seventy-three musicians were categorized into four groups of high and low AP and RP, and were tested on two tasks: identifying chord types (Task 1), and identifying a single note within a chord (Task 2). A main effect of RP on Task 1 and an interaction between AP and RP in reaction times were found. On Task 2 main effects of AP and RP, and an interaction were found, with highest performance in participants with both high AP and RP. Results suggest that AP and RP should be regarded as two different abilities, and that AP may slow down reaction times for tasks requiring global processing.  相似文献
